Amazon Lex

Amazon Lex is a fully managed artificial intelligence (AI) service with advanced natural language models to design, build, test, and deploy conversational interfaces in applications. It provides the deep learning functionalities of automatic speech recognition (ASR) for converting speech to text, and natural language understanding (NLU) to recognize the intent of the text, enabling you to build applications with highly engaging user experiences and lifelike conversational interactions.

Features 6

Notable capabilities this provider offers.

Automatic Speech Recognition

Convert speech to text with high accuracy using the same deep learning technology as Amazon Alexa.

Natural Language Understanding

Understand the intent behind user input to build conversational interfaces.

Multi-Channel Deployment

Deploy bots across web, mobile, messaging channels (Slack, Facebook Messenger, Twilio), and contact centers.

Amazon Connect Integration

Build intelligent contact center bots with native integration with Amazon Connect.

Streaming Conversations

Support multi-turn streaming conversations for complex dialog flows.

Intent Recognition

Recognize user intents and extract slot values from natural language input.

Use Cases 4

What developers build with this provider.

Customer Service Chatbot

Build self-service chatbots for customer support and FAQ handling.

Contact Center Automation

Automate contact center interactions with intelligent IVR and agent assist.

Internal Help Desk

Create employee-facing bots for IT help desk and HR self-service.

E-Commerce Assistant

Build shopping assistants that understand natural language product queries.

Integrations 4

Pre-built integrations with other platforms and tools.

Amazon Connect

Deploy Lex bots in Amazon Connect contact flows for IVR and agent assist.

Amazon Kendra

Combine Lex for dialog management with Kendra for intelligent document search.

AWS Lambda

Use Lambda for fulfillment logic and business rules in bot conversations.

Amazon Polly

Convert bot text responses to natural speech using Amazon Polly TTS.
